What is Optimus EMR?
Optimus EMR System is a cloud-based electronic medical record that is developed to be used in long term care practices only. The solution can be used in medium-sized practices, large practices, and small-sized practices of the long term care. The solution improves the efficiency of the work that is done by the care providers and keeps a record of all the data collected from the patients. the solution can also be customized by the users.The main features that are available in Optimus EMR System include claims management, patient records, and staff scheduling among others. Optimus EMR System is developed and distributed by a company called Optimus EMR. The company was started in the year 2000 and it is located in the united states.

The cost of license starts at $500 per user/month. ITQlick pricing score is 4.8 out of 10 (10 is most expensive). Access ITQlick pricing guide for Optimus EMR.Pros
- The solution is reliable enough because it provides both backup and data security
- Optimus EMR System can be integrated with other existing applications as well as new ones
- The solution offers excellent customer support that is always available
Cons
- Optimus EMR System price is high and most users cannot afford it
- The solution is only cloud-based and hence not flexible
